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
61534625 3499614813 648148557 351467638 4673
874654 4480166
874654 4480166
25 1752 663388
All about undefined
Interested in learning more?
874654 4480166
25 1752 663388
See more
0804 12900
608880 602 1008
See more
039336823 98556342 546
24837 4933750696 1890 788107241
See more